Karl Theodore Bitter

Karl Bitter was an American sculptor of Austrian origin. He is known as a master of neoclassicism in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Bitter became famous for his decorative relief decorations on the facades of municipal buildings and private residences. Among the creative achievements of the master are also numerous monuments to prominent compatriots.

Karl Bitter was one of the most successful immigrant artists in U.S. history. During his lifetime, he received many awards from the American government, and shortly before his tragic death at the age of 47, he was elected president of the National Society of Sculptors of the United States.

Date and place of birt:6 december 1867, Vienna, Austria
Date and place of death:9 april 1915, New York City, USA
Nationality:Austria, USA
Period of activity: XIX, XX century
Specialization:Artist, Sculptor
Art style:Neoclassicism
